保护 PLC 程序免受破解的全面策略 (plc中有哪些程序保护环节)

保护

概述

可编程逻辑控制器 (PLC) 在工业自动化系统中起着至关重要的作用。它们负责控制复杂的机器和过程,因此保护其程序免受破解至关重要。如果 PLC 程序被破解,可能会导致生产中断、安全风险和财务损失。

PLC 程序保护环节

以下是保护 PLC 程序免受破解的一些关键环节:

硬件安全措施

使用加密 PLC:加密 PLC 可以防止未经授权的用户访问其程序。限制对 PLC 硬件的物理访问:控制对 PLC 及其连接的物理访问,以防止未经授权的修改。启用硬件看门狗:硬件看门狗会在 PLC 出现故障或受到攻击时自动重置它。

软件安全措施

编写安全代码:遵循安全编码实践,例如使用强密码、避免缓冲区溢出和跨站点脚本 (XSS) 攻击。使用密码保护:为 PLC 访问和编程设置强密码,并定期更改密码。限制用户访问:仅授予经过授权的用户访问和修改 PLC 程序的权限。使用版本控制:使用版本控制系统管理 PLC 程序的更改,并记录所有修改。禁用调试模式:调试模式允许用户访问 PLC 程序的底层代码。在部署之前应禁用此模式。

网络安全措施

使用 VPN 或专用网络:使用虚拟专用网络 (VPN) 或专用网络将 PLC 与其他系统隔离。使用防火墙:部署防火墙以阻止未经授权的网络流量进入 PLC。启用入侵检测系统 (IDS):部署 IDS 以检测和阻止网络攻击。定期更新软件:定期更新 PLC 软件和固件,以修补安全漏洞。

其他安全措施

员工培训:对员工进行 PLC 安全实践的培训,以提高对潜在威胁的认识。物理安全:确保

本文原创来源:电气TV网,欢迎收藏本网址,收藏不迷路哦!

相关阅读

添加新评论